Republicans can slowly have an impact in various blue areas, if they mount the right kinds of efforts.

When Obama took office, Arkansas had:
1 Dem governor
2 Dem US senators
3 of 4 Dem House seats
Dems in most upper level state offices

When Obama left office, Arkansas had:
1 Repub governor
2 Repub US senators
4 of 4 Repub House seats
Repubs in most upper level state offices

Most of the South was solid Dem for around 150 years following the Civil War. Now, most of the South is solid or definitely leaning Repub.
